The 95th annual National Cherry Festival took place in Michigan, USA recently.

Arnold Amusement provides fairs and festivals with unique and fun rides and attractions, which is what they did once again at the National Cherry Festival this year.

However, on Thursday night, one of the rides experienced a malfunction. Have a look here:

We love a great team effort from strangers and, in this instance, they did their best to try and save the situation. 

The people on the ground collaborated and grabbed hold of the fencing around the base of the ride to try and steady it. 

A witness shared with UpNorthLive that the ride finally came to a stop and they managed to get the harnesses locked.

There were no injuries endured, fortunately!
